The Consumer Manager role will lead, advance and manage the Health, Beauty & Pets (HBP) categories within the Consumables line of business (LOB) for Australia and New Zealand (ANZ) cluster, delivering on commercial and strategic objectives.


This role will also support the Senior Commercial Manager in New Business development and contribute towards commercial goals of the division, by delivering compelling merchandise at retail and enriching consumers' experiences.


  • This is a 12 month Fixed Term Contract

Areas of Responsibility:

Commercial

  • Delivery of the Annual Operating Plan (AOP) targets across HBP categories, licensees and retailers across all Walt Disney Company brands (Disney, LucasFilm, Marvel, 21st Century Studios, National Geographic).
  • Manage licensee's financial reporting within the required quarterly timelines.
  • Lead contractual management and renewal discussions with support from Finance.

Category management and development

  • Build and develop strategic plans for sustainable category growth across HBP categories.
  • Partner management and development of strong business relationships with licensees and business managers through regular joint business planning sessions and open dialogue.
  • Cultivate strong retail relationships and demonstrate in depth understanding of retail ways of working to support category growth (Grocery and Pharmacy).
  • Identify and focus on unlocking new product category and distribution channel opportunities across all consumer segments.
  • Demonstrate and champion operational effectiveness by making timely, insightbased, solution oriented decisions

New Business Development

  • Develop clear, insight and data driven strategies that deliver on new business roadmap and vision.
  • Proactively look for new opportunities and challenge the status quo.
  • Set out clear rationale and context for new business recommendations.
  • Effective pitch building that delivers clear, compelling and visually impactful narrative.
